Top Cat (voiced by Arnold Stang in the style of comedian Phil Silvers) was the main character in the prime-time animated situation comedy Top Cat, which ran for 30 episodes from 1961 to 1962 on ABC, later airing in Saturday-morning reruns on NBC and (later) in syndication and on Cartoon Network.

His "birthday" is May 29th.

Personality

Top Cat (or T.C.) is the leader of a gang of alley cats. He is a con cat who makes his living by being somewhat lazy and clever. He often steals others' ideas and tricks his gang and Officer Dibble, using schemes to make his feline life more comfortable. He does respect the gang, but takes advantage of others' naïveté. Even though he seems selfish, lazy and conniving, T.C. is loyal to the gang and will come to their assistance if necessary.

In Top Cat: The Movie (2011), T.C. meets his new love interest: a female cat by the name of Trixie.
